After Ed (http://aftered.tv) is a non-profit, web-channel on the future of education, produced at Teachers College Columbia University. Since July 2007, we have been producing short web videos for a global audience attuned to developments in the education sector.

A few weekends ago, I overheard my friend (and former roommate) Christian discussing a Ted Talk that he had recently watched, and immediately we started brainstorming a possible video ideas. To frame the video in terms of the After Ed channel "target," it seemed a good idea to look at the creativity and sustainability sections. I think that this video shows not only best practices vis-a-vis how to get a specific technology into a school, but also the transformative effect that the sharing of ideas between teachers and students can have. I am bowled over that kids from Christian's science club were so willing to be on camera to talk about their experiences.
